Well after all the phone calls I am getting about this and all the info on the news about the FBI and IRS coming down on Mike Vorce

I thought i better clear something up since my reputation is at issue here and many people thought i still worked at The Wharf

I saw this coming a while ago and was waiting for Mike Vorce to fall of his throne

I was GM at The Wharf last year and oversaw all the upgrades and improvements as well as runnning the day to day. Then on laborday weekend after much praise about how great a job I had been doing I was asked by Mike Vorce to resign with no real explanation as to why


It turns out i had been asking to many questions about his financial dealings relative to the business i was charged to run for him

The man did me a favor as his suspicious financial activities were far reaching beyond our small operation

He did not live up to his financial commitments to me and i got screwed out of a chunk of money as well
all be it much less that the millions he owes the banks

The Wharf itself is a great place to have a boat and the original owner of the facility has taken it back over and put some folks in charge that should see it through a smooth operation

Mike Vorce was only a lessee of the facility but according to the news last night he defaulted on taxes and monthly payments on the marina this winter (No surprise here)

I am sure the Wharf will still be one of the best places to hang your boating hat for the summer

I am glad i saw this early as had it all gone down on my watch i would have got sucked in by association

Some times what goes around really does come around
